Trials Rising Gold Edition on the Nintendo Switch is a fantastic package, especially for players who want to take its challenging, "physics-bending" gameplay anywhere. The Switch port is very solid, and while it has some minor technical compromises, the core experience is intact.

Porting a physics-heavy game like Trials Rising to a handheld console required compromise, but the result remains highly playable.

At launch, the Switch version faced minor optimization hurdles. The latest resolves these bottlenecks, delivering a much more stable frame rate, which is absolutely critical for hitting frame-perfect bunny hops and landings.
